Paper 8658
Paper 8658
Paper 8658
IJARSCT
International Journal of Advanced Research in Science, Communication and Technology (IJARSCT)
Abstract: Communication through web is turning out to be crucial nowadays. An online communication
permits the clients to speak with others in a quick and advantageous manner. Considering this, the online
communication application should be capable offer the writings or pictures or some other documents in a
quicker manner with least postponement or with no deferral. Firebase is one of the stages which gives an
ongoing information base and cloud administrations which permits the designer to make these applications
effortlessly. Texting can be considered as a stage to maintain communication. Android gives better stage to
create different applications for texting contrasted with different stages like iOS. The fundamental target of
this paper is to introduce a product application for the starting of a continuous communication between
administrators/clients. The framework created on android will empower the clients to speak with another
clients through Chat messages with the assistance of web. The framework requires both the gadget to be
associated through web. This application depends on Android with the backend given by google Firebase.
Keywords: Communication; Firebase; Android; Chat Messaging; Real-Time Databases; Group Messaging
I. INTRODUCTION
In reality the communication assumes an indispensable part. Individuals have been speaking with one another through
different applications or mediums. In the first place individuals spoke with one another utilizing letters or different
sources, as these mediums could set aside much effort to convey the substance. Cells are another mechanism of
communication however the downside is for any restricted or little message which should be passed to another client at
that point call is certifiably not an ideal way. The engineers at that point hoped to execute a book based communication
which would permit an in moment communication administration. In 1984, the idea of SMS was created in the Franco
German GSM participation by Friedhelm Hillebrand and Bernard Ghillebaert. The restriction of SMS was the restricted
size i.e., 128 bytes, after the ascent of cell phones from 10 years many informing applications have been created.
Some are Bluetooth based and some were web based, for example, WhatsApp, WeChat and others. Android is a
working framework for mobiles which was created by google. This working framework permits the applications to be
utilized on mobiles. As it was created by google, android clients can create versatile applications and can be sold
through android application stores, for example, play store. Firebase is a NoSQL data set which utilize attachments
which permits the clients to store and recover the database. An Android version should be greater than 2.3, android
studio 1.5 or higher version, and android studio project are the essentials to interface the firebase to an android
application. Firebase gives a different sort of administrations, for example,
Firebase Authentication is helpful to the two engineers and the clients. Creating and keeping up sign-in set-up
might be somewhat troublesome and time taking. Firebase gives a simple API to sign in. It additionally gives
the information reinforcement utilizing continuous data sets.
Firebase cloud for putting away the information like video, text, pictures assembling the framework would be
troublesome and costly for another engineer so the firebase gives the foundation of distributed storage.
Ongoing data set it is a cloud facilitated NoSQL data set. Aside from the validation, cloud administration and real-time
databases firebase additionally offers an assistance for crash announcing Crash Reporting: when some sudden accidents
happen in any applications it could be hard to close why the application slammed. Firebase gives crash revealing help to
manage these accidents. This paper is worried of a product application for the foundation of an ongoing communication
administrations between administrators/clients. Visit application many-to- many kind of communication framework
2.1 Objectives
The essential objective is to make a framework which can make chatroom as indicated by the clients and store the
connected information at a solitary spot. To execute the continuous visiting application which can permit to the client to
make moment bunch messages. Executing google firebase cloud and constant data sets to store the information.
Supriya S. Pore, Swalaya B. Pawari conducted a comparative study of SQL and NoSQL. The study highlights on the
types of databases like SQL and NoSQL, it also differentiates among them. The Axiomatic of SQL and NoSQL
databases has been described in this paper. The study says that due to data consistency, ACID property is not used in
the NoSQL databases
Vatika Sharma, Meenu Dave have given an overview of NoSQL databases focusing on how it has declined the
dominance of SQL with its background and characteristics.
Daniel Pan in his article has shown how to connect firebase to an Android app and basics of designing the structure of
database in Firebase.
Landon Cox study highlights the comparison between SQLite and firebase. It also focuses on organizing data in the
form of JSON tree in order to store in Firebase.
Our first target: to maintain categories and add subcategories to allow people to find what they were looking for more
quickly. Our second target was to subtly suggest popular dishes that were quick to prepare. Less prep time meant faster
deliveries and so we introduced Recommendations.
Figure 3: Pie chart showing the percentage of usage in different types of communication
Purpose of using
Texting
Image sharing
Figure 4: Pie chart for percentage of user preference in the communication applications.
Many talking applications are arising nowadays and are being utilized by individuals viably. To build up the
application, the client criticism about what is required and what is existing in the current applications accessible.
V. RESULT
The last framework will result as a constant communication application which gives the clients to convey to one another
no sweat. The application will have a login page through which the client can enroll and login themselves. Landing
page of the application contains the past messages assuming any. The client can be ready to look for the other client.
Client can send and get Chat messages. The client can make talk rooms and can look for the substance or data. With
these visit rooms clients can trade perspectives and data about different themes. The character of the client can likewise
be disclosed covered up in these visit rooms.
REFERENCES
[1]. Forensics study of IMO call and chat app M.A.K. Sudozai, Shahzad Saleem, William J.Buchanan, Nisar
Habib, Haleemah Zia
[2]. Android based instant messaging application using firebase Article • January 2019 Sai Spandhana Reddy
Emmadi, Sirisha Potluri
[3]. Instant Messaging Service on Android Smartphones and Personal Computers Priya Mehrotra1, Tanshi
Pradhan2 and Payal Jain
[4]. Architecture and Implementation of the Instant Messaging in Educational Institution Budi Yulianto, Eileen
Heriyanni, Lusiana Citra Dewi, and Timothy Yudi Adinugroho
[5]. Implementation Application Internal Chat Messenger Using Android System Robi Sanjaya Abba Suganda
[6]. Designing and Implementation of the Instant Communication system Based on the Android Platform
Terminal Ma J.Z., Shao Fang, L.P. Hu, J.
[7]. Liu and D.M. Chen, Security analysis testing for secure instant messaging in android with study case:
Telegram Aditya Candra;